Criminal Mischief, Trespassing: Wall Police Blotter

Wall Police reported two incidents of criminal mischief from Nov. 6 through Nov. 10.

WALL, NJ — Wall Police reported incidents of criminal mischief, theft and more from Nov. 6 through Nov. 10.

Nov. 6
Richard Rogalski, 54, of Ocean Grove, was arrested and charged with criminal mischief and defiant trespass after he was found throwing bricks through the windows of a Wall Church Road building. He was processed and released on a summons.

Nov. 8
David Angello, 53, of Wall Township, was arrested and charged with contempt of court. He was processed and brought to the Monmouth County Correctional Institution.

Nov. 10
William Schreiber, 47, of Parlin, was arrested and charged with theft by unlawful taking and criminal mischief following an investigation at 2301 Atlantic Avenue. He was processed and released on a summons.
